There seems to be no sense of accountability in Indian politics. Let us just take the recent cases of our Civil Aviation Minister and Food and Supplies Minister. When they were elected to power and were given these portfolios, the food prices were not beyond reach of the common man as they are today, nor were the national airlines in as poor a shape as they are today. By leading their respective subjects to doom due to irresponsible actions and policies, now they want a change of portfolio! They want to move out to greener pastures for obvious reasons. Though our Prime Minister has refused to do so for the time being, it won’t be long before these guys get their way. It is so unfortunate that they get away with murder and daylight robbery as they have mastered the art of fooling all the people all the time.
If anybody dares point a finger at them, they just turn around and say, ‘We have been elected’ and continue the loot and pillage. Just before the elections, they will give some sops to the electorate, and the public memory being what it is, will get back to power. The majority of our population live from meal to meal and they will be forever grateful to anyone who will provide them meals for a week.
This is democracy manipulated to suit the fancies of the rich and powerful.
Sad but true.
